Financial Investment and Payment Options

Affordable Tuition Structure

Pulse Radiology Institute offers straightforward and affordable tuition for Santa Clara, CA students, with full tuition of only $23,250 that includes all educational components and supplies needed for successful program completion. Our organized payment schedule starts with a accessible $100 registration fee and a modest $5,000 down payment, maintained by convenient monthly payments of just $900 for the duration. This financial plan allows Santa Clara, CA students to finish their training without loans, eliminating the debt load that commonly follows conventional college programs. The graduation fee of $150 is due before degree conferral, concluding the full tuition obligation.

If you start searching online, you’ll quickly discover that dozens of schools claim to offer the “best” MRI training. The question is: how do you know which ones are worth your time and investment? Enrolling in the right MRI online programs is essential whether you’re just starting your journey toward becoming a technologist or you’re already working in the field and need continuing education for ARRT requirements.

Choosing wisely isn’t always easy, but it’s worth the effort. The right program can strengthen your résumé, prepare you for certification, and give you the confidence you need to succeed in this growing field. The wrong choice, however, could leave you frustrated, unprepared, or even ineligible for certification. Here’s what you should keep in mind when evaluating your options.

Flexibility That Fits Your Life

Flexibility is one of the main reasons students choose online learning in the first place, but not all programs deliver it in the same way. Some programs mimic traditional classrooms with fixed schedules and live video lectures. While this format offers real-time interaction with professors, it may not work well if you’re juggling a full-time job or family responsibilities.

Other programs provide recorded lectures, video modules, and self-paced coursework. This style of learning allows you to log in when it works for you—early mornings, late nights, or weekends. For many busy professionals, this approach is ideal. It lets you stay on track without forcing you to rearrange your entire life.

When researching programs, ask yourself: Will this structure fit my lifestyle? If the answer is no, keep looking until you find one that offers the right balance of flexibility and accountability.

Accreditation: Non-Negotiable for Certification

Perhaps the most critical factor to consider is accreditation. No matter how polished a program looks, if it isn’t accredited by the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) or another recognized governing body, your coursework may not count toward certification.

Accreditation ensures that the program meets industry standards, covers the required material, and prepares you for exams. An accredited program will also carry more weight on your résumé, signaling to employers that you’ve received legitimate, high-quality training.

Some accredited programs go a step further by offering mock exams, so you can get a sense of the ARRT certification experience before test day. This extra practice can be invaluable in building both knowledge and confidence.

Coursework That Covers the Essentials

A strong MRI program should provide a comprehensive curriculum that prepares you for both certification and day-to-day practice. At a minimum, expect to see courses covering:

  • MRI procedures: Operating scanners, following safety protocols, and managing patients during scans.

  • Sectional anatomy and physiology: Understanding the body in detail so you can capture the images physicians need.

  • Pathology basics: Recognizing abnormal tissues and understanding why certain scans are ordered.

  • Medical terminology: Building fluency in the language of healthcare so you can communicate effectively with doctors and colleagues.

Programs that emphasize these areas give you the tools to produce accurate, high-quality images and work seamlessly within healthcare teams.

Clinical Training: The Missing Piece in Many Programs

One of the most overlooked aspects of online education is clinical training. No amount of video lectures or reading modules can replace the value of hands-on practice. That’s why clinical training is a requirement for ARRT certification.

During this stage of your education, you’ll work in a hospital, clinic, or imaging center under the supervision of an experienced technologist. You’ll practice operating scanners, positioning patients, and following safety protocols in real-world conditions. This experience is what transforms theoretical knowledge into practical skill.

When comparing programs, be sure clinical training is included in the curriculum. If it isn’t, you may find yourself scrambling to secure experience later—which can delay your certification and career plans.
